首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何有条件地格式化数据帧

数据帧格式化是在计算机网络中常见的数据传输方式,它将数据划分为固定大小的块,以便在网络中传输。下面是关于如何有条件地格式化数据帧的答案:

数据帧格式化是将数据划分为固定大小的块,以便在计算机网络中传输。它通常用于在数据链路层上进行数据传输,以确保数据的可靠性和完整性。数据帧通常由帧头、数据部分和帧尾组成。

有条件地格式化数据帧可以通过以下步骤实现:

  1. 确定数据帧的大小:根据网络的需求和传输介质的限制,确定数据帧的大小。常见的数据帧大小包括Ethernet的最大帧大小为1500字节。
  2. 添加帧头:帧头包含了一些必要的信息,如源地址、目标地址、帧类型等。帧头的长度通常是固定的,并且在数据链路层的协议中定义。
  3. 添加数据部分:将要传输的数据划分为适当大小的块,并将它们添加到数据帧中。数据部分的大小通常是根据网络需求和传输介质的限制来确定的。
  4. 添加帧尾:帧尾通常包含一些校验信息,如循环冗余校验(CRC)码,用于检测数据传输过程中的错误。帧尾的长度通常是固定的,并且在数据链路层的协议中定义。
  5. 发送数据帧:将格式化后的数据帧发送到目标设备或网络。

有条件地格式化数据帧可以根据不同的需求和网络环境进行调整。例如,如果需要提高数据传输的可靠性,可以增加帧头和帧尾的校验信息,以便在接收端进行错误检测和纠正。如果需要提高数据传输的效率,可以减小数据帧的大小,以减少传输延迟和网络带宽的占用。

腾讯云提供了一系列与云计算相关的产品,如云服务器、云数据库、云存储等。这些产品可以帮助用户在云环境中进行数据存储、计算和传输。具体推荐的产品和产品介绍链接地址可以参考腾讯云官方网站的相关页面。

请注意,以上答案仅供参考,具体的数据帧格式化方法和推荐的产品可能因实际需求和环境而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券